MoneywebNOW

Moneyweb brings you the latest in business and financial news in our new morning podcast: MoneywebNOW with Simon Brown.

The show will offer the latest in business, trading and company news to best prepare listeners for the day ahead. It will be live-streamed via the Moneyweb website and mobile app between 06:30 and 06:50.
